Let G=(V, E) be a graph where V and E are the vertex and edge set, respectively. For two disjoint subsets A and B, we say A dominates B if every vertex of B is adjacent to at least one vertex of A. A vertex partition π= \V1, V2, …, Vk\ of G is called a transitive k-partition if Vi dominates Vj for all i,j where 1≤ i
